Alsa

About
Alsa is the main provider of bus travel in Spain and a subsidiary of the UK’s National Express. It operates an extensive network of regional, national, and international routes, transporting more than 300 million passengers annually. Alsa’s modern fleet offers varying levels of comfort and amenities. The standard Alsa Normal buses include free Wi-Fi, onboard bathrooms, footrests, and entertainment. For a more premium experience, Alsa Supra, Alsa Eurobus, and Alsa Premium services provide enhanced comfort and luxury features.

FlixBus

About
FlixBus is one of Europe’s leading low-cost bus companies, founded in Germany and now offering long-distance services across Europe and the United States. In addition to its extensive daytime network, FlixBus also operates overnight buses on select European routes. Standard amenities include free Wi-Fi, power outlets to charge devices, extra legroom, luggage space, and onboard toilets, with snacks and drinks available for purchase. FlixBus offers a single Standard ticket type for all routes, which includes one carry-on bag and one checked bag per passenger. Additional fees apply for extra luggage and for reserving specific seats, such as Extra Seats, Table Seats, or Panorama Seats. This combination of affordability, comfort, and wide coverage makes FlixBus a popular choice for budget-conscious travelers.

BlaBlaCar Bus

About
BlaBlaCar Bus (formerly known as Ouibus or iDBUS) is a long-distance coach company operating in 10 European countries and connecting over 300 destinations. A subsidiary of the French carpooling company BlaBlaCar, it offers comfortable travel with standard amenities such as air conditioning, toilets, USB and power outlets for charging devices, extra legroom, and adjustable seats. Free Wi-Fi is available on select routes. BlaBlaCar Bus offers only a Standard ticket type, which allows passengers to bring one carry-on bag and up to two checked bags per person.

Some of the most interesting sights to explore in Alicante are:
  • Santa Bárbara Castle, a historic fortress offering panoramic views of the city and the Mediterranean Sea
  • Explanada de España, a picturesque promenade lined with palm trees and vibrant mosaic tiles
  • Alicante Museum of Contemporary Art, showcasing a collection of 20th-century Spanish art
  • Basilica of Santa Maria, the oldest active church in Alicante with Gothic and Baroque architectural elements
  • Mount Benacantil, a prominent hill offering hiking trails and stunning views of the city.
The best things to do in Alicante include:
  • Postiguet Beach, a popular urban beach ideal for sunbathing and swimming
  • Tabarca Island, a small island perfect for a day trip with opportunities for snorkeling and exploring
  • Alicante Central Market, a bustling market where you can sample local delicacies and fresh produce
  • Canelobre Caves, impressive caves with stunning stalactite formations
  • Take a scenic boat tour along the Costa Blanca coastline.

Since both Porto and Alicante are in the Schengen Area, a passport is not required for European Union (EU) or Schengen-associated country citizens. A national ID card is sufficient.
We recommend using the flight as it is the most popular way to get from Porto to Alicante among Omio's users.
Spain uses the euro (€) as its currency. Travelers can use both cash and cards, but cards are widely accepted in cities and tourist areas, while cash may be preferred for small purchases, markets, and rural locations.
In Alicante, travelers should be cautious of pickpocketing, especially in crowded areas like markets, public transport, and popular tourist sites. Common scams include overcharging in taxis without meters and unofficial currency exchange booths with unfavorable rates. It is advisable to use authorized services and remain vigilant in busy spots to avoid these issues.
